Data Engineer (snowflake, Dbt)

Year    TS, IN, India

Job Description



We are looking for an experienced and results-driven Data Engineer to join our growing Data Engineering team.

The ideal candidate will be proficient in building scalable, high-performance data transformation pipelines using Snowflake and dbt or Matillion and be able to effectively work in a consulting setup.

In this role, you will be instrumental in ingesting, transforming, and delivering high-quality data to enable data-driven decision-making across the client's organization.

Key Responsibilities



1. Design and implement scalable ELT pipelines using dbt on Snowflake, following industry accepted best practices.

2. Build ingestion pipelines from various sources including relational databases, APIs, cloud storage and flat files into Snowflake.

3. Implement data modelling and transformation logic to support layered architecture (e.g., staging, intermediate, and mart layers or medallion architecture) to enable reliable and reusable data assets..

4. Leverage orchestration tools (e.g., Airflow,dbt Cloud, or Azure Data Factory) to schedule and monitor data workflows.

5. Apply dbt best practices: modular SQL development, testing, documentation, and version control.

6. Perform performance optimizations in dbt/Snowflake through clustering, query profiling, materialization, partitioning, and efficient SQL design.

7. Apply CI/CD and Git-based workflows for version-controlled deployments.

8. Contribute to growing internal knowledge base of dbt macros, conventions, and testing frameworks.

9. Collaborate with multiple stakeholders such as data analysts, data scientists, and data architects to understand requirements and deliver clean, validated datasets.

10. Write well-documented, maintainable code using Git for version control and CI/CD processes.

11. Participate in Agile ceremonies including sprint planning, stand-ups, and retrospectives.

12. Support consulting engagements through clear documentation, demos, and delivery of client-ready solutions.

Required Qualifications



3 to 5 years of experience in data engineering roles, with 2+ years of hands-on experience in Snowflake and DBT or Matillion (Matillion-DPC is highly preferred, not mandatory


Experience building and deploying DBT models in a production environment.

Expert-level SQL and strong understanding of ELT principles. Strong understanding of ELT patterns and data modelling (Kimball/Dimensional preferred)

.



Familiarity with data quality and validation techniques: dbt tests, dbt docs etc

.
Experience with Git, CI/CD, and deployment workflows in a team setting

Familiarity with orchestrating workflows using tools like dbt Cloud, Airflow, or Azure Data Factory.

Core Competencies:



o Data Engineering and ELT Development:



Building robust and modular data pipelines using dbt. Writing efficient SQL for data transformation and performance tuning in Snowflake. Managing environments, sources, and deployment pipelines in dbt.

o Cloud Data Platform Expertise:



Strong proficiency with Snowflake: warehouse sizing, query profiling, data loading, and performance optimization.

Experience working with cloud storage (Azure Data Lake, AWS S3, or GCS) for ingestion and external stages

.
'

Technical Toolset:



o Languages & Frameworks:

Python

: For data transformation, notebook development, automation.

SQL

: Strong grasp of SQL for querying and performance tuning.
Job Type: Full-time

Pay: ₹1,200,000.00 - ₹1,500,000.00 per year

Application Question(s):

Year of Experience in Snowflake and DBT or Matillion? (Please mention separately for DBT and Matillion) ? Year of Experience in Matillion Architecture? (all layers) (in years) ? Year of Experience in SQL and Python? Experience in cloud storage (Azure Data Lake, AWS S3, or GCS)? (preferably Azure Data Lake) ? Experience in Matillion-DPC? ? Experience in SSIS ? Your Notice Period?
Work Location: In person

Beware of fraud agents! do not pay money to get a job

MNCJobsIndia.com will not be responsible for any payment made to a third-party. All Terms of Use are applicable.


Job Detail

  • Job Id
    JD4857776
  • Industry
    Not mentioned
  • Total Positions
    1
  • Job Type:
    Full Time
  • Salary:
    Not mentioned
  • Employment Status
    Permanent
  • Job Location
    TS, IN, India
  • Education
    Not mentioned
  • Experience
    Year